Endocrine-paracrine cell types in the prostate and prostatic adenocarcinoma are postmitotic cells.

Abstract

Neuroendocrine (NE) differentiation frequently occurs in common prostatic malignancies and has potential prognostic and therapeutic implications. In a recent study we were able to provide immunohistochemical evidence that endocrine-paracrine cell types represent an androgen-insensitive cell population in prostate cancer, documented by the consistent lack of the pertinent receptor. In this study we investigated the proliferative activity of endocrine-paracrine cell types in normal, hyperplastic, and neoplastic prostate tissue. Using double-label techniques for the endocrine marker chromogranin A (chr A) and the proliferation-associated MIB-1 antigen, we evaluated the proliferative status of endocrine-paracrine cell types in the prostate and prostatic adenocarcinoma showing marked NE differentiation. In this series of carcinomas and in nonneoplastic tissue the proliferative activities were exclusively restricted to nonendocrine cell populations, whereas endocrine-paracrine cell types characterized by Chr A consistently lack MIB-1 immunoreactivity. This may indicate that prostatic endocrine-paracrine cell types do not participate in the cell cycle during normal, hyperplastic, and neoplastic prostatic growth. Based on the present information, the endocrine phenotype can be considered to be an androgen-insensitive, postmitotic subpopulation in the prostate and prostate cancer.

摘要

神经内分泌(NE)分化在常见的前列腺恶性肿瘤中经常发生,并且具有潜在的预后和治疗意义。在最近的一项研究中,我们能够提供免疫组织化学证据,表明内分泌旁分泌细胞类型代表前列腺癌中对雄激素不敏感的细胞群体,相关受体的持续缺失证明了这一点。在本研究中,我们调查了正常、增生和肿瘤性前列腺组织中内分泌旁分泌细胞类型的增殖活性。使用针对内分泌标志物嗜铬粒蛋白A(chr A)和增殖相关的MIB-1抗原的双标记技术,我们评估了前列腺和显示明显NE分化的前列腺腺癌中内分泌旁分泌细胞类型的增殖状态。在这一系列癌组织和非肿瘤组织中,增殖活性仅局限于非内分泌细胞群体,而以Chr A为特征的内分泌旁分泌细胞类型始终缺乏MIB-1免疫反应性。这可能表明,在正常、增生和肿瘤性前列腺生长过程中,前列腺内分泌旁分泌细胞类型不参与细胞周期。基于目前的信息,内分泌表型可被认为是前列腺和前列腺癌中对雄激素不敏感的有丝分裂后亚群。
